Rechercher : dans
Par :

Javascript, tout cocher

Dernière réponse le 4 mar 2008 à 01:43:53 fatabien, le 15 mai 2003 à 15:42:23 
 Signaler ce message aux modérateurs

J'ai trouvé des scripts pour permettre de cocher toutes les checkbox d'un formulaire. Sauf que dans mon cas, le nom de mes cases à cocher est 'Dest[]' , et ces scripts ne marchent pas pour des tableaux.

fatabien
www.rock-insight.fr.st

Meilleures réponses pour « javascript, tout cocher » dans :
Javascript - Librairies d'effets pour vos images VoirAu gré de vos explorations du web, vous avez vu de superbes effets de présentation des images. Et ça vous plairaît bien de pouvoir proposer les mêmes à vos visiteurs. Voici quelques solutions en Javascript couplées à des CSS. Elles sont plus...
YouTube - Vous avez désactivé JavaScript VoirProblème Lorsque vous naviguez sur certains sites, tels que YouTube, ceux-ci affichent le message d'erreur suivant : Vous avez désactivé JavaScript ou bien vous possédez une ancienne version d'Adobe Flash Player. Téléchargez la dernière version...
Javascript - Coloration syntaxique dans vos pages web VoirSi vous avez un site web contenant des exemples de code (php, javascript, C#, Delphi, Python...), il peut être intéressant d'avoir une coloration syntaxique. C'est parfois pénible à réaliser, mais il existe une librairie Javascript qui permet de...
Javascript - Les événements VoirQu'appelle-t-on un événement? Les événements sont des actions de l'utilisateur, qui vont pouvoir donner lieu à une interactivité. L'événement par excellence est le clic de souris, car c'est le seul que le HTML gère. Grâce au Javascript il est...
Javascript - Les variables VoirLe concept de variable Une variable est un objet repéré par son nom, pouvant contenir des données, qui pourront être modifiées lors de l'exécution du programme. En Javascript, les noms de variables peuvent être aussi long que l'on désire,...
Javascript - Introduction au langage Javascript VoirQu'est-ce que le Javascript? Le Javascript est un langage de script incorporé dans un document HTML. Historiquement il s'agit même du premier langage de script pour le Web. Ce langage est un langage de programmation qui permet d'apporter des...

1

jojo, le 15 mai 2003 à 17:14:24
  • +1

Encore toé????!!!!!

pfffff...

inspire toé de ca

-------------------------------------------------------
<html>
<head>
<script language="JavaScript">
function cocher()
{
with (document.formu)
{
for (i = 0; i < c.length; i++)
c[i].checked = true;
}
}
</script>
</head>
<body>
Sélectionner les cases à cocher:
<form name="formu">
<input type="checkbox" name="c">jvé te cocher n1
<br>
<input type="checkbox" name="c">jvé te cocher n2
<br>
<input type="checkbox" name="c">jvé te cocher n3
<br>
<input type='button' onclick='cocher()' value="cocher">
</form>
</body>
</html>
-------------------------------------------------------

si cest pas ca que tu demandais explike nous mieux tes contraintes et pkoé tu as ces contraintes histoire de voir si on peut les contourner

Répondre à jojo

2

 laserator, le 4 mar 2008 à 01:43:53
  • +1

Bonsoir


je rencontre le meme probleme, mais je vais le detailler d'avantage.

En fait, j'ai plusieurs listes de personnes : list1, list2, list3.
dans chacune de ces listes, je veux avoir la possibilite de selectionner ttes les checkbox, ou de tout decocher.
pr cela, le nom des checkbox doit etre identique partout de la forme :

<input name="list1" value="1" type="checkbox"></td></tr>
<tr><td class="gris">personne1</td><td class="gris">p1</td><td class="gris">
<input name="list1" value="1" type="checkbox"></td></tr>
<tr><td class="gris">personne2</td><td class="gris">p2</td><td class="gris">
....

Or, si je veux recuperer les valeurs de mes checkbox une fois le formulaire soumis, il faut que le nom des checkbox soit ss forme de tableau afin d'obtenir chacune de leur valeur.

D'ou :
list1[]

et la, ca coince pr la selection de ttes les cases comme decrit ci-dessus : je butte la


Dilemme, savez-vous quelle solution je pourrais utiliser ?

Merci d'avance

Répondre à laserator
Collection CommentÇaMarche.net